1. Set the geographic boundary before reviewing news
Port Isabel and Cameron County are not interchangeable labels. The Census record identifies Port Isabel city as a municipality in Cameron County, Texas, and records a population estimate of 5,111 for the 2020–2024 ACS 5-year period. That fact can help a firm define its local reference point, but it cannot show how many people search for legal information or where prospective clients come from. A Legal News review should therefore ask how stories involving Port Isabel, Cameron County, and Texas would be handled separately. A statewide legal development may matter to a Port Isabel practice even when it does not mention the city. A local incident may be relevant only if it connects to a practice area the firm actually serves.
